NeuroRein_UWS is a non-invasive brain-computer interface monitoring and assessment platform developed by Hangzhou Yuyi Technology; the current version is for clinical research use only, has not yet obtained medical device registration, and its ethics review is still in progress. The system passively and non-invasively collects EEG and physiological signals, and serves only to assist monitoring and assessment of consciousness and brain-function trends — it performs no therapeutic intervention. Its outputs are for doctors' clinical reference only, do not constitute a clinical diagnosis, and do not replace the independent judgment of a licensed doctor. All use follows data-protection measures including de-identification, informed consent, encryption, and audit logging.
